What is configuration drift, and how does Reach monitor for it?
Configuration drift happens when security settings move away from their intended state over time. A policy gets adjusted, a break-glass exception gets forgotten, an overly permissive rule sneaks in, a product update ships, and nothing alerts the team that something changed for the worse and created a defensive weakness that attackers can exploit. Reach continuously monitors your security control configurations across IAM, EDR, email security, firewalls, SASE, and more, and alerts you to changes that affect your security posture. Reach keeps a full audit trail, prioritizes fixes, provides guided remediation of drift events, and continues to scan for drift events even after issues have been resolved. How is Reach different from vulnerability management, CAASM, and EASM tools?
Those tools answer different questions. Vulnerability management finds software flaws, CAASM inventories your assets, and EASM scans your internet-facing surface. None of them tell you whether the security controls you already deployed are configured correctly and doing their job. Reach focuses on your security control plane: finding misconfigurations, drift, and unused capabilities inside the tools you own, then fixing them.
